To be honest the title is a bit unfair as this wasn't really a fail run but it amused me never the less.
So I popped on at 8.30 this morning as I wanted to get a daily heroic done as I was getting booted of the Internet shortly due to my lovely wife wanting to catch up on last nights rugby game and hogging all the bandwidth by downloading it on BBC Iplayer.
So first try in LFG one of the DPS (and sorry but it is always dps for me) didn't accept the invite guess coffee was brewing or the online porn he was watching while waiting was at a critical stage maybe.
But second try no problem I got into a group for Halls of Stone but they had done one boss which always makes me a little suspicious as generally people only drop a group if it really sucks. So I quickly scope out the tanks hit points just to make sure of the level of healing I need to put out and hes rocking at 51K hit points so I thought no issues should be an ok run maybe their healer disconnected or something.
We hit the maiden of Grief and it seemed to take a long time for her to die we missed the speed kill by quite a margin which is odd these days. I decided to inspect the dps to see what was happening not that I was really bothered as the boss died its just that the tank out dpsed the whole group.
I think the gods of LFG were have a laugh with poor Zetter and for that matter the tank on this fine Saturday. To get one poor dps can be considered normal, to get two can be considered unlucky but all three!!!!
The pally was wait for it wielding Stormherald yep I am not joking the level 70 crafted mace! I guess he missed all those blue or even green upgrades white he was leveling to 80 but hey purple is best as we all know.
The hunter had a green two hander and didn't actually have one gem or enchant on any of his gear and I swear was using auto shot through the whole fight, the lock also seemed to have passed the gem wagon by though he did at least seem to know there were other spells he could use apart from Shadowbolt.
Now the run went fine, ok it was a lot longer than I thought it would be with the tank manfully or should I say dwarfully putting out a fair portion of the DPS. But I dont think I have ever seen such a collection of dps in one place at the same time. Oddly enough though a couple of them actually had I level 264 bits (ungemmed of course) not sure if this was to push their gearscore up or they had used all their gold for wine, women and song.
I thanked them all at the end of the run for the group and resisted the temptation to ask if they had ever wondered what those sockets in the armour were for ( I dunno maybe they thought they were for putting flowers in or something).

An aversion to letting people die no matter how stupid they are!
Like I think everyone else in the blog sphere I have been running heroics every day for frost badges and I have been reading the various stories about peoples mishaps with the LFG system with amusement.
One think I have found in the annoying tendency of people mainly DPS (hey its a numbers game there are more of them in an instance) to STAND IN DANGEROUS CRAP as hey the healer
geared and you wouldn't want to lose your place on the meters by having to move.
Now being a druid raid healing is sort of a natural focus as most of our spells are geared that way. Of course in 10 mans I tend to be a jack of all trades but if there is raid healing to be done im your man (or tree). I have found this has come over into when I run heroics as I tend to have an almost compulsion not to let the groups bars drop even when people stand in the aforementioned DANGEROUS CRAP.
I find myself going to extraordinary lengths to save even the most suicidal lemming from certain death its almost automatic. Pally DPS pulls the boss for a few on a regular basis you can bet I have a swiftmend ready to save him. In fact because tanks are so well geared now its even easier as you can let the tank merrily fight on with a hot on him while you sort out mr aggro puller.
Is this an issue any other healers have with LFG is there some sort of group I can join like healer anonymous? "Hi i'm Zetter and I cant stop healing idiots".
Zetter
P.S Maybe I am starting to break the cycle I had a newly geared tank in Halls of Stone today who to be fair was doing a good job apart from the bloody fury warrior who seemed determined to pull threat off him at every opportunity. Eventually I found myself playing a game and seeing how low I could let the warrior get before I bothered to heal him. Three deaths later he dropped the group and we got in someone more sensible.
